英文摘要To identify the anti-human immunodeficiency virus type 1 (HIV-1) activities of α-momorcharin (α-MMC) from momordica charantia in acutely and chronically infected Tlymphocytes. METHODS: The anti-HIV activities of -MMC were examined by 1) the inhibition of syncytia formation inducedby HIV-1 ⅢB; 2) reduction of p24 core antigen expression level and decrease in numbers of HIV antigen positive cells in acutely and chronically infected cultures. The cytotoxic effects of α-MMC was tested by trypan blue dye exclusion or colorimetric MTT assay. RESULTS: α-MMC wasfound to obviously inhibit HIV-1 ⅢB-inducing C8166 syncytia formation and markedly reduced both expression of p24 core antigen and the numbers of HIV antigen positive cells in acutely but not chronically HIV-1-infected culture. The median effective concentration (EC=50) in these assays were 0.016, 0.07, and 0.32 mg.L^1, respectively. CONCLUSION: α-MMC is a unique component of momorcharin with anti-HIV activity, and markedly inhibited HIV-1replication in acutely but not chronically HIV-1-infected T-lymphocytes.
